KIMCoreChatInfo

会话元信息

Constructors

Link copied to clipboard
constructor()
constructor(metaEntity: <Error class: unknown class>)
constructor(metaInfo: <Error class: unknown class>)

Properties

Link copied to clipboard
@SerializedName(value = "adminAddOnly")
var adminAddOnly: Boolean

管理员才能加人 默认关闭

Link copied to clipboard
@SerializedName(value = "admins")
var admins: List<String>

管理员id列表

Link copied to clipboard
@SerializedName(value = "changeChatInfo")
var changeChatInfo: Boolean

群信息修改 默认关闭

Link copied to clipboard
@SerializedName(value = "chatId")
var chatId: String

会话ID

Link copied to clipboard
@SerializedName(value = "ctime")
var ctime: Long

会话创建时间

Link copied to clipboard
@SerializedName(value = "customData")
var customData: String

自定义属性

Link copied to clipboard
@SerializedName(value = "forbidEndTime")
var forbidEndTime: Long

封禁截止时间

Link copied to clipboard
@SerializedName(value = "isDisableAll")
var isDisableAll: Boolean

是否全员禁言

Link copied to clipboard
@SerializedName(value = "isForbid")
var isForbid: Boolean

是否被封禁,被封禁后,不能进行任何操作

Link copied to clipboard
@SerializedName(value = "joinApprove")
var joinApprove: Boolean

进群审核 false:默认关闭 true: 进群审核

Link copied to clipboard
@SerializedName(value = "memberCount")
var memberCount: Int

群聊时,群成员总数

Link copied to clipboard
@SerializedName(value = "name")
var name: String

会话名称

Link copied to clipboard
@SerializedName(value = "owner")
var owner: String

群主id

Link copied to clipboard
@SerializedName(value = "targetBizUid")
var targetBizUid: String

单聊的时候,对方的用户ID

Link copied to clipboard
@SerializedName(value = "type")
var type: Int

会话类型 com.kingsoft.kim.core.Constant.CHAT_TYPE

Functions

Link copied to clipboard
Link copied to clipboard
fun setCustomData(customData: String?)